Citikey Free Business Directory
Register Free
Add
{{#signedin}}
{{/signedin}} {{^signedin}}
{{/signedin}}
{{#items}}
{{name}}
{{section}}
{{/items}}
Restaurant - Chinese in Town Centre, Leicester
Royal Chef
Narborough Road, Town Centre, Leicester LE3 0DL
Tastes
Meridian Way, Town Centre, Leicester LE19 1JZ
Noodle House
Narborough Road, Town Centre, Leicester LE3 0BS